Zebra ZC300t error 5002: Ribbon synchronization failure
The Zebra ZC300t error 5002 typically occurs during ribbon initialization. It means the printer hardware cannot detect the panel transitions correctly. This guide provides steps to resolve ribbon synchronization issues efficiently.

Solutions
Quick Diagnosis
If your printer flashes error 5002, the ribbon is likely loose or not fully locked in the cartridge. This stops the printer from identifying color segments.Step-by-Step Solution
- Open the printer's ribbon compartment.
- Remove the ribbon cartridge.
- Check for any slack or torn ribbon film.
- Tighten the ribbon by turning the spool.
- Click the cartridge back into place.
Maintenance
Use cleaning cards provided by Zebra periodically to keep the card path and sensors clean.When to Call a Technician
If the ribbon remains undetected with a fresh supply, the internal sensor board may require professional repair.Technical Specifications
